The European Union has approved the transfer of approximately €1.5 billion from profits generated by frozen Russian central bank assets to Ukraine. This funding will be used to help Ukraine repay loans for weapons and other military support. Croatia has decided to draw from the European Union’s €150 billion defence loan facility to provide military support to Ukraine. This move is part of efforts to equip Ukraine amid ongoing challenges.
